One of the most used pans in any well-equipped kitchen. Skillets have sloped sides so that foods slide out easily. Used for cooking omelets, pancakes, quesadillas, sautéing vegetables, searing steaks, fish and poultry.

Features:

  • Stainless steel base fully encapsulates an aluminum core for fast, even heating.
  • TOTAL® Hi-Low Food Release System that's metal utensil safe plus an easy-to-clean nonstick exterior.
  • Dishwasher safe hard-anodized cookware suitable for all stove tops, including induction.
  • Cast stainless steel handles and professional quality stainless steel lids.
  • Oven safe to 500°F.

    Cooking Tip From the Food Network Kitchens

    Reducing a sauce? Use a skillet; its larger surface area reduces sauces faster than simmering them in a saucepan.
